An important role in the construction industry is played by the robotics of individual processes in construction. However, despite a wide range of scientific and design developments in the field of construction, the level of automation and robotization processes remains quite low. This is due to the need to systematize the performed research and development, to carry out complex research and development activities. The paper presents data on the technological prerequisites for robotization of construction processes in Russia. The factors hindering the use of industrial robots in Russia are identified. The distinctive parameters and characteristics of robots in the construction of unique buildings and structures are considered. The main tasks for robotization of technological processes at construction enterprises are formulated. The analysis of the levels injuries at construction sites is carried out. The possibility of introducing robotic technology in the construction of unique buildings with complex technical features is considered. As a result of the research carried out, the scientific problem of analysis and synthesis specialized robots for the construction of unique buildings and structures has been considered. The solution to this problem is important, since it contributes to the development of highly effective means of complex mechanization and automation of construction processes that increase the productivity and quality of installation, finishing and plastering works, reduce their labor intensity, free people from harmful and dangerous working conditions.
